Announcing AssetWise APM v7.9

We are pleased to announce the release of AssetWise APM v7.9, now available for general access from Bentley Software Downloads. This version of Bentley’s asset reliability software introduces asset condition analysis, the next step beyond prioritization analysis to determine when to repair or replace equipment.

Highlights

  • Asset Condition Analysis (ACA) -- Assess the current state of assets, typically to determine at what intervals assets are to be repaired or replaced. The analysis employs user-defined criteria reflecting your organization’s business goals (for example, availability of parts and software, and frequency and effort of maintenance). ACA is included in the Asset Health application module

  • ACA and Asset Prioritization Analysis -- ACA is aligned with Asset Prioritization Analysis, which determines the relative importance of assets in terms of risk. You can create a condition analysis from within a prioritization analysis. Then view condition values and consequence priority numbers in the asset’s window. And go to the Priority and Condition matrix to see matches for all assets at the site.

  • Invoice templates (EAM product module) – You can now create invoice templates, perfect for regularly recurring expenses such as utility bills.

  • Invoice reversals -- You can reverse invoices that were posted with errors or mistakenly. The process includes reversing liabilities, PO lines, and inventory.

  • Support for UTC --The APM server and database now support Coordinated Universal Time (UTC). Date and time data is stored in the database and displayed in some locations as UTC. However, wherever dates and times are displayed in clients, the data is converted to the time zone assigned to the enterprise.
